Medical treatments include topical aluminium chloride, oral anticholinergic agents, iontophoresis, and botulinum type A injections. Surgical treatments include direct axillary sweat gland removal and thoracoscopic sympathectomy.

Web1 dag geleden · If the sweating occurs as a result of another medical condition, it is called secondary hyperhidrosis. The sweating may be all over the body (generalized) or it may be in one area (focal). Conditions that cause secondary hyperhidrosis include: Acromegaly; Anxiety conditions; Cancer; Carcinoid syndrome; Certain medicines and substances of … WebIf the sweating occurs as a result of another medical condition, it is called secondary hyperhidrosis.
